Skip to content

Commit

Permalink
project files: make use of side-by-side google libs
Browse files Browse the repository at this point in the history
- Alters the vc8 and 9 project files to use vc version designated
  paths of google test and mock.

[#19]

Signed-off-by: Thell Fowler <git@tbfowler.name>
  • Loading branch information
Thell Fowler committed Jan 19, 2010
1 parent 32b9c6f commit 68e6dee
Show file tree
Hide file tree
Showing 8 changed files with 58 additions and 14 deletions.
4 changes: 0 additions & 4 deletions PowerEditor/visual.net/environment_lib_paths.vsprops
Original file line number Diff line number Diff line change
Expand Up @@ -8,10 +8,6 @@
Name="VCCLCompilerTool"
AdditionalIncludeDirectories="&quot;$(envGTEST_DIR)\include&quot;;&quot;$(envGMOCK_DIR)\include&quot;"
/>
<Tool
Name="VCLinkerTool"
AdditionalLibraryDirectories="&quot;$(envGTEST_DIR)\msvc\$(ConfigurationName)&quot;;&quot;$(envGMOCK_DIR)\msvc\$(ConfigurationName)&quot;"
/>
<UserMacro
Name="envGTEST_DIR"
Value="$(GOOGLE_TEST_DIR)"
Expand Down
26 changes: 26 additions & 0 deletions PowerEditor/visual.net/lib_paths.8.vsprops
Original file line number Diff line number Diff line change
@@ -0,0 +1,26 @@
<?xml version="1.0" encoding="Windows-1252"?>
<VisualStudioPropertySheet
ProjectType="Visual C++"
Version="8.00"
Name="lib_paths"
InheritedPropertySheets=".\submodule_lib_paths.vsprops;.\environment_lib_paths.vsprops"
>
<Tool
Name="VCLibrarianTool"
AdditionalLibraryDirectories="$(ENV_LIB_PATHS);$(SM_LIB_PATHS)"
/>
<Tool
Name="VCLinkerTool"
AdditionalLibraryDirectories="$(ENV_LIB_PATHS);$(SM_LIB_PATHS)"
/>
<UserMacro
Name="SM_LIB_PATHS"
Value="&quot;$(smGTEST_DIR)\msvc\vc8\$(ConfigurationName)&quot;;&quot;$(smGMOCK_DIR)\msvc\vc8\$(ConfigurationName)&quot;"
PerformEnvironmentSet="true"
/>
<UserMacro
Name="ENV_LIB_PATHS"
Value="&quot;$(envGTEST_DIR)\msvc\vc8\$(ConfigurationName)&quot;;&quot;$(envGMOCK_DIR)\msvc\vc8\$(ConfigurationName)&quot;"
PerformEnvironmentSet="true"
/>
</VisualStudioPropertySheet>
26 changes: 26 additions & 0 deletions PowerEditor/visual.net/lib_paths.9.vsprops
Original file line number Diff line number Diff line change
@@ -0,0 +1,26 @@
<?xml version="1.0" encoding="Windows-1252"?>
<VisualStudioPropertySheet
ProjectType="Visual C++"
Version="8.00"
Name="lib_paths"
InheritedPropertySheets=".\submodule_lib_paths.vsprops;.\environment_lib_paths.vsprops"
>
<Tool
Name="VCLibrarianTool"
AdditionalLibraryDirectories="$(ENV_LIB_PATHS);$(SM_LIB_PATHS)"
/>
<Tool
Name="VCLinkerTool"
AdditionalLibraryDirectories="$(ENV_LIB_PATHS);$(SM_LIB_PATHS)"
/>
<UserMacro
Name="SM_LIB_PATHS"
Value="&quot;$(smGTEST_DIR)\msvc\vc9\$(ConfigurationName)&quot;;&quot;$(smGMOCK_DIR)\msvc\vc9\$(ConfigurationName)&quot;"
PerformEnvironmentSet="true"
/>
<UserMacro
Name="ENV_LIB_PATHS"
Value="&quot;$(envGTEST_DIR)\msvc\vc9\$(ConfigurationName)&quot;;&quot;$(envGMOCK_DIR)\msvc\vc9\$(ConfigurationName)&quot;"
PerformEnvironmentSet="true"
/>
</VisualStudioPropertySheet>
4 changes: 2 additions & 2 deletions PowerEditor/visual.net/notepadPlus.8.vcproj
Original file line number Diff line number Diff line change
Expand Up @@ -20,7 +20,7 @@
OutputDirectory="$(ConfigurationName)"
IntermediateDirectory="$(ConfigurationName)"
ConfigurationType="1"
InheritedPropertySheets=".\submodule_lib_paths.vsprops;.\environment_lib_paths.vsprops"
InheritedPropertySheets=".\lib_paths.8.vsprops"
CharacterSet="1"
>
<Tool
Expand Down Expand Up @@ -116,7 +116,7 @@
OutputDirectory="$(ConfigurationName)"
IntermediateDirectory="$(ConfigurationName)"
ConfigurationType="1"
InheritedPropertySheets=".\submodule_lib_paths.vsprops;.\environment_lib_paths.vsprops"
InheritedPropertySheets=".\lib_paths.8.vsprops"
CharacterSet="1"
WholeProgramOptimization="1"
>
Expand Down
4 changes: 2 additions & 2 deletions PowerEditor/visual.net/notepadPlus.9.vcproj
Original file line number Diff line number Diff line change
Expand Up @@ -21,7 +21,7 @@
OutputDirectory="$(ConfigurationName)"
IntermediateDirectory="$(ConfigurationName)"
ConfigurationType="1"
InheritedPropertySheets=".\submodule_lib_paths.vsprops;.\environment_lib_paths.vsprops"
InheritedPropertySheets=".\lib_paths.9.vsprops"
CharacterSet="1"
>
<Tool
Expand Down Expand Up @@ -119,7 +119,7 @@
OutputDirectory="$(ConfigurationName)"
IntermediateDirectory="$(ConfigurationName)"
ConfigurationType="1"
InheritedPropertySheets=".\submodule_lib_paths.vsprops;.\environment_lib_paths.vsprops"
InheritedPropertySheets=".\lib_paths.9.vsprops"
CharacterSet="1"
WholeProgramOptimization="1"
>
Expand Down
4 changes: 0 additions & 4 deletions PowerEditor/visual.net/submodule_lib_paths.vsprops
Original file line number Diff line number Diff line change
Expand Up @@ -8,10 +8,6 @@
Name="VCCLCompilerTool"
AdditionalIncludeDirectories="&quot;$(smGTEST_DIR)\include&quot;;&quot;$(smGMOCK_DIR)\include&quot;"
/>
<Tool
Name="VCLinkerTool"
AdditionalLibraryDirectories="&quot;$(smGTEST_DIR)\msvc\$(ConfigurationName)&quot;;&quot;$(smGMOCK_DIR)\msvc\$(ConfigurationName)&quot;"
/>
<UserMacro
Name="smGMOCK_DIR"
Value="$(SolutionDir)google_mock"
Expand Down

0 comments on commit 68e6dee

Please sign in to comment.